Is arubaito worth it for 6 months in Japan?

I might be going to Japan in October (japanese school), not 100% confirmed, for 6 months.
The question is by the time one gets settled in properly, is it worth pursuing a part time or should I just focus on studying and exploring?
Money is not an issue but it feels weird to spend 6 months without a salary.

Any suggestions is appreciated.

  2. If money isn’t an issue then focus on exploring, making friends, and seeking out new experiences.

    Just try to stay out of an English bubble.

    Have fun!

  3. If money is not an issue, get over feeling weird and enjoy. No reason to spend a good chunk of each week stocking shelves in a conbini or something equally mundane.

  4. If you only hang around English speakers at school then get a job. It is a great way to meet natives and learn different language skills.
